Black Diamond Freewire Quickdraws

The Black Diamond Freewire Quickdraws are some of the lightest quickdraws on the market. They’re made with aluminum wiregate carabiners, and they have a polyester dogbone. The Freewire Quickdraws are available in a 12-pack for $99.95.

Pros:

Lightweight

Strong

Affordable

Cons:

Not as durable as some other quickdraws

Petzl Djinn Quickdraws

The Petzl Djinn Quickdraws are made with aluminum wiregate carabiners, and they have a polyester dogbone. The Djinn Quickdraws are available in a 6-pack for $59.95.

Pros:

Lightweight

Strong

Cons:

More expensive than some other quickdraws

Not as durable as some other quickdraws
